… or so they claim to be.  I kind of believe it.  The right ingredients are there.  1200hp, weights much lighter than the Veyron, and cost more than a million bucks.  The only thing missing is if the aerodynamics can handle that much wind resistance.  This is 1 of the 4 Hennessey Venom GTs here in the US and this is Chassis #4.  Kinda cool actually.  Don’t know if they have to paint it bright ass yellow tho.  Other than that, this car is bat shit crazy and hyper fast.

Probably one of the most beautiful car in the show floor.  A Foose Auto built Mercedes 300SL Gullwing.  Such a beautiful car.  Flawless in every way.

The Pike’s Peak Hill Climb record breaker, Monster Sport’s Suzuki SX4 driven by Monster Tajima.  If you’re wondering why it’s called Tajima San is called Monster, you should see what he looks like.
